To illustrate the availability, effectiveness, and practical use of Open-Source tools in developing a radiology paper from
its beginning to its presentation and publication. Practical use of a complete set of Open-Source applications for writing,
e-mail corresponding, slide show, image retrieval, and manipulation is shown by simulating a scientific paper development.
Open-Source software proved to be an inexpensive, effective, widely compatible, and user-friendly alternative to commercial
toolkits in developing and deploying a scientific paper, either on paper or on slide show.
